Fire Weather Planning Forecast For CEN/ERN VA...NE NC...MD ERN SHORE
National Weather Service WAKEFIELD VA
411 AM EDT Wed May 13 2026

.DISCUSSION...
A breezy S wind prevails today, with min RH values from 30 to 40%
as a cold front approaches from the west. Showers become likely
across northern portions of the area tonight with a chance for
southern Virginia and NE NC. Average rainfall amounts are expected
to be at or below 0.10" for all but the northern areas. Mainly
dry with NW winds Thursday and Friday. Min RH values will mostly
be from 35 to 45% Thursday, and 25 to 35% Friday.

     NC USERS
===================================================================
VENTILATION RATE         BURN CATEGORY
===================================================================
0 TO 14759                    0
14760 TO 33499                1
33500 TO 44999                2
45000 TO 59999                3
60000 TO 111999               4
112000 OR GREATER             5

     NC USERS
===================================================================
FORECAST SURFACE WIND    DISPERSION
===================================================================
NEAR CALM                  STAGNANT
2 TO 4 MPH                 VERY POOR
5 TO 8 MPH                 POOR
9 TO 12 MPH                FAIR
GREATER THAN 12 MPH        GOOD
